Default Help! Looking for a new 1 w a 48mm nut

I'm looking for a new nylon string guitar with a 48mm nut width (1 7/8")

I know of the options in the name factory brands (ex- Cordoba's crossover series)

The finish on the last Cordoba I had was so incredibly thick I really felt like it took away from the guitars sound. It was alot more of a reflective sound which my ears don't prefer.


Can you guys recommend some good websites/dealers?

Preferences:
  • 48mm nut width(A must)
  • Preferably a full 25.5" Scale length
  • 'Full body' rather than 'thin body'
  • Thinner finish than the thick poly on the cordobas
